"prevalent methods" is a grammatically correct and commonly used phrase in written English.
It can be used to describe the most commonly used or widely accepted approaches or techniques for achieving a certain goal or solving a problem. Example: In today's fast-paced business world, efficient time management techniques are essential. Among the prevalent methods used by successful professionals are prioritizing tasks, setting clear goals, and delegating responsibilities.
